Concord Wealth Partners lowered its stake in AT&T Inc. (NYSE:T – Free Report) by 13.9% during the second quarter, according to the company in its most recent filing with the SEC. The institutional investor owned 6,500 shares of the technology company’s stock after selling 1,047 shares during the quarter. Concord Wealth Partners’ holdings in AT&T were worth $188,000 as of its most recent filing with the SEC.

AT&T Announces Dividend
The company also recently declared a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Monday, November 3rd. Investors of record on Friday, October 10th will be issued a dividend of $0.2775 per share. This represents a $1.11 dividend on an annualized basis and a yield of 4.3%. The ex-dividend date of this dividend is Friday, October 10th. AT&T’s dividend payout ratio (DPR) is presently 63.07%.

AT&T Company Profile
AT&T, Inc is a holding company, which engages in the provision of telecommunications and technology services. It operates through the Communications and Latin America segments. The Communications segment offers wireless, wireline telecom, and broadband services to businesses and consumers located in the US and businesses globally.
